Universal’s Supply Chain Integrity Program has several components, each of which plays a role in assuring the total quality of our product. The components align with the Company’s quality, efficiency, and financial goals, and they accomplish the essential functions of defining best practices and documenting our responsibilities in each key area of the supply chain.
Good Agricultural Practices (GAP)
Promoting, using and further developing sound leaf production techniques and strategies which meet our customers’ needs, promote farmer success, and support a sustainable environment.
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P)
Using best practices and developing improved technologies to optimize results in our processing facilities and meet or exceed customer requirements.
Environmental Performance
Monitoring our industrial activities and the implementing strategies to comply with all laws and regulations and reduce our environmental impact.
Health & Safety
Protecting our workforce, contractors, and visitors by creating and maintaining a workplace free of recognized hazards.
Product Integrity & Traceability
Assuring product quality throughout the supply chain.
Social Responsibility Programs
child labor
Maintaining a commitment to addressing child labor issues.
employee protection and development
Adhering to the conventions of the International Labour Organization (ILO) and continuously training and developing our employees.
community involvement
Contributing to our communities through volunteer service and financial support of community improvement initiatives.
Industry Involvement
Participating in organizations, committees, and other groups addressing industry issues and concerns.
